Switch dashboard to watcher-based multi-disk view, fix transcoding FPS display

- dashboard.html: remove standalone "Mounted Disk" input panel; show all disks
  from GET /api/disks (watcher), auto-refresh every 5s
- detect.go: use avg_frame_rate when r_frame_rate is unrealistic (>120 fps or 0),
  fixes MJPEG/mjpeg showing 90000fps
- transcoder.go: parse fps= from ffmpeg progress output and expose in Progress struct
- copier.go: update task message with real-time encoding fps (@ 45.3 fps),
  clear speed_bps/eta during transcoding to avoid showing stale copy speed
